Transaction 2bfd690781e4102f16487637f96c91ae29ff900ca47dab18ad4eb3876359d701
1 Input
2 Outputs
- 2bfd690781e4102f16487637f96c91ae29ff900ca47dab18ad4eb3876359d701:0
- 2bfd690781e4102f16487637f96c91ae29ff900ca47dab18ad4eb3876359d701:1
value 438762
address 1GSvYjW3x7aTNrirAcmcbLZKQY8xCQujCw
value 19724000
address 3B7f3Fhpvo6mLsxJ3paSmoFEGkFcam5LtA